Erros, bugs, perguntas - página 3105

 
Andrey Dik #:

Esta construção não pode ser feita de tal forma que se tenha de colocar ";" no final?

Em MQL pode colocar ; em qualquer espaço livre

 
A100 #:

Em MQL pode colocar ; em qualquer espaço livre

Eu sei, mas o problema é diferente. As IDEs de terceiros não compreendem esta construção sem ;, por isso a formatação do código é efectuada incorrectamente.

Andrey Dik#:

É possível fazer esta construção para colocar ";" no final?

Quer dizer, colocar; aqui mesmo que não precise de MQL5? - Hmm, desculpe, mas cheira a "kolkhoz" e a amadorismo desnecessário.
 
zl5766 #:

Terminal construído em 3099 em mac. A auto-substituição está a aderir em ME.

Ao digitar o código, aparece uma barra de substituição amarela e se premir enter, a barra congela onde se encontra o cursor do rato nesse momento.

Esta risca fica então no ecrã em cima de todas as janelas. Foto em anexo....

Desaparece quando fecho todas as janelas relacionadas com o MT5.


Alguém sabe como pará-lo?

Tenho o mesmo problema no Ubuntu 18.04 XFCE desde há muito tempo antes de 3081.

 
Andrey Dik #:
Quer dizer que tem de usar; aqui mesmo que não precise de MQL5? - Hmm, desculpe, mas cheira a "kolkhoz" e a amadorismo desnecessário.

Quando a MQL ainda não tinha funções virtuais puras - também era preciso colocar uma função extra - eu coloquei uma função extra e nada de mal aconteceu

 

Olá, por favor informe onde escavar, o problema é o seguinte:

versão terminal 5.0.0.3104 deixou subitamente de funcionar (sem ligação ao corretor)

Até às 24.00 horas, hora de Moscovo, ontem estava a funcionar, e hoje já não(!

E o corretor não tem problemas, e o MT4 opera normalmente)

O que foi feito: Desinstalei, reinstalei (não ajudei)

O que foi feito: reinicialização,limpeza de pastas,limpeza manual do registo,reinicialização,reinstalação(sem resultado)

Configuração da minha velha senhora:

DELL INSIRON N5110 8gb RAM CPU i7-2670QM CPU @ 2.2 GHZ

WIN7 máximo sp1

O tamanho da pasta de história P.S. era quase 3gb

Obrigado de antemão.

 
Como é que o depurador sabe o que a função devolveu?
 
fxsaber #:
Como pode o depurador descobrir o que a função devolveu?

Atribuir a execução de uma função a uma variável e colocá-la em observação.

 
fxsaber #:
Como pode o depurador descobrir o que a função devolveu?
Aparentemente, só tem de inserir uma variável que aceite temporariamente o valor da função, se esta não for fornecida.
 
Alexey Viktorov #:

Atribuir a execução da função a uma variável e colocá-la (a variável) em observação.

Nikolai Semko #:
Aparentemente, só tem de inserir uma variável que tome temporariamente o valor da função, se esta não for fornecida.

Deve haver uma forma normal.

 
fxsaber #:

Tem de haver uma forma normal.

Em depuradores normais, sim - tudo está lá.
Há muitas coisas lá dentro. Por exemplo, o último valor devolvido é realçado directamente no código e os nomes das variáveis não têm de ser introduzidos manualmente.